The Economic Underpinnings of Uneven Broadband Deployment
The primary driver behind less connectivity in the suburbs and rural neighborhoods is, at its core, economic. Internet service providers (ISPs) are businesses driven by profit margins. The cost of deploying and maintaining high-speed internet infrastructure, particularly fiber optics, is substantial. In densely populated urban areas, these costs are spread across a larger customer base, making the return on investment more attractive.
Higher Per-Customer Infrastructure Costs: In rural and many suburban areas, the physical distance between potential customers is significantly greater. Laying cables across vast tracts of land or through challenging terrain incurs substantial labor and material expenses. This means the cost to connect each individual household is considerably higher than in a city block.
Lower Population Density: Fewer households per square mile translate directly to fewer potential subscribers for ISPs. This lower density makes it difficult for providers to recoup their initial investment in infrastructure within a reasonable timeframe.
Competitive Landscape: Urban areas often have multiple ISPs vying for customers, fostering competition that drives innovation and investment in network upgrades. In contrast, many rural and suburban locales have limited, if any, choice, often dominated by a single provider with little incentive to expand or upgrade services.
Regulatory Hurdles and Policy Gaps
Beyond pure economics, regulatory frameworks and policy decisions play a significant role in perpetuating less connectivity in the suburbs and rural neighborhoods. The interplay between federal, state, and local regulations can create complex landscapes that either encourage or hinder broadband expansion.
Permitting and Rights-of-Way: Obtaining permits for laying fiber or installing other necessary infrastructure can be a protracted and costly process. Varying regulations across different jurisdictions can add layers of complexity for providers looking to expand their reach.
Subsidies and Incentives: While government programs exist to subsidize broadband deployment in underserved areas, they are often insufficient to cover the full cost of ambitious projects. Furthermore, the application and distribution of these funds can be bureaucratic and slow-moving.
Defining “Underserved”: The very definition of what constitutes an “underserved” area can be a point of contention. If an area has some form of internet access, even if it’s slow and unreliable dial-up or a weak DSL signal, it might not qualify for certain funding or regulatory attention, leaving residents with effectively less connectivity.
Technological Challenges and Geographical Realities
The physical landscape itself can present formidable obstacles to achieving universal connectivity. Certain geographical features inherently make infrastructure deployment more difficult and expensive.
Terrain and Natural Barriers: Mountains, dense forests, and large bodies of water can make laying fiber optic cables prohibitively expensive or technically challenging. These natural barriers often isolate communities, exacerbating the problem of less connectivity in the suburbs and rural neighborhoods.
Existing Infrastructure Limitations: In older suburban developments, infrastructure may not have been designed with high-speed digital communication in mind. Retrofitting these areas can be more complex than building out new networks in undeveloped regions.
Spectrum Availability for Wireless: While wireless solutions like 5G or fixed wireless access (FWA) offer promising alternatives, their effectiveness can be limited by terrain, foliage, and available spectrum. Line-of-sight requirements for some FWA technologies can make deployment in hilly or wooded areas problematic.
The Ripple Effect: Consequences of Digital Exclusion
The impact of less connectivity in the suburbs and rural neighborhoods extends far beyond mere inconvenience. It creates a tangible digital divide with profound social and economic consequences.
Economic Disadvantage: Businesses in these areas struggle to compete in an increasingly digital marketplace. The inability to reliably use cloud services, process online transactions, or engage in e-commerce puts them at a significant disadvantage. This also limits opportunities for remote work, a growing sector that could revitalize local economies.
Educational Gaps: Students in areas with poor connectivity face significant hurdles in accessing online learning resources, completing homework, and participating in virtual classrooms. This educational disparity can have long-term implications for their future prospects.
Healthcare Access: Telehealth services, which offer a lifeline for many in remote areas, are severely hampered by unreliable internet. Accessing remote medical consultations, monitoring devices, and health information becomes a significant challenge.
Social Isolation: In an age where social connections are increasingly mediated online, limited connectivity can contribute to feelings of isolation, particularly for seniors or those with mobility issues. Access to online social networks, news, and community information is restricted.
Exploring Solutions for a Connected Future
Addressing the pervasive issue of less connectivity in the suburbs and rural neighborhoods requires a multi-pronged approach involving public policy, technological innovation, and community engagement.
Public-Private Partnerships: Encouraging collaboration between government entities and private ISPs can help de-risk infrastructure investments and accelerate deployment. This could involve subsidies, tax incentives, or joint ventures.
Community Broadband Initiatives: Empowering local communities to take a more active role in broadband planning and deployment, sometimes through municipal networks or co-operatives, can offer tailored solutions.
Leveraging Emerging Technologies: Exploring the potential of satellite internet, advanced fixed wireless technologies, and even drone-based connectivity could provide viable alternatives in extremely challenging terrains.
* Revising Regulatory Frameworks: Streamlining permitting processes, re-evaluating subsidy structures, and ensuring accurate mapping of broadband availability are critical steps.
